Pogba hopes to win trophies with Man Utd after coronavirus

Paul Pogba have said that Red Devils want to get back to playing and winning trophies.

Most League and sport across the world have been brought to a standstill due to the coronavirus pandemic out break more than 33,900 death recorded globally and 720,000 cases.

With the lockdown on going in the United Kingdom, Pogba – who has been linked with a move to former club Juventus and La Liga giants Real Madrid – had a message for United fans.

"Stay at home - stay safe," Pogba said in a video call with team-mate Jesse Lingard via the club's official website. "Keep supporting United.

"Hopefully things will get better very soon and we will get back to the game.

"Hopefully we can show you guys we are ready and we want to go back to win trophies.

"Stay connected, stay safe and we'll be back on the pitch soon."
